    P&P Group Background )

    The P&P Group has been active in the real estate industry for over 30 years. With its Real Estate Investment division, the Group has set the goal of identifying the potential of urban living spaces and creating sustainable added value for our society. P&P Group is a long-term oriented, owner-managed real estate investor and project developer, that originated in Germany. In 2022, the Group opened its London office in Mayfair and has plans to replicate the German business in the UK market. In Germany, the group employs >100 employees across Munich, and Nuremberg. With its investment arm Rivus Capital, the group further invests in Private Equity and Venture Capital.

    Junior Residential Real Estate Investment Associate

    Tasks:

    • Assist in sourcing value-add residential opportunities across London with a target timeline of 6-12 months for potential sale.
    • Support project management efforts for value-add strategies, including refurbishments and lease condition improvements, under the guidance of senior team members and external third parties.
    • Assist in the preparation of sales materials and participate in negotiations with potential buyers under supervision.
    • Contribute to expanding the UK network of relevant market participants on both the buy-side and sell-side, including agents, high net-worth individuals (HNWIs), family offices, developers, and architects.
    • Coordinate and participate in business meetings to introduce the CEO and discuss investment opportunities.
    • Assist in preparing decision papers, including basic investment calculations and economic feasibility studies.
    • Support market trend analysis and competitor research to inform investment strategy.
